When you stand up to signal to your communication partner that a visit is over, you are using nonverbal communication to __________ interaction.
a. regulate
b. hide
c. impact
d. channel
When you stand up to signal to your communication partner that a visit is over, you are using nonverbal communication to regulate interaction. So, the correct option is A.
Nonverbal communication is defined as the process of communication through sending and receiving wordless messages. It includes the use of gestures, facial expressions, and body language to express oneself or communicate with others.
Regulating interaction is one of the most important functions of nonverbal communication. By regulating interaction, nonverbal cues can help manage communication. When you stand up to signal to your communication partner that a visit is over, you are using nonverbal communication to regulate interaction by signaling that the visit has come to an end and that it is time to leave.
Hence, the correct option is A. regulate.

Differentiate between movement and locomotion
Answer:
Locomotion is the displacement of a body from one place to another. On the contrary, movement is the displacement of a body or a part of the body from its original position.

from what language does the kitchen term "mise en place" originate?
The term "mise en place" originates from the French language.
The term "mise en place" is widely used in the culinary world and it comes from the French language. In French, "mise en place" literally means "put in place" or "set up." It refers to the practice of preparing and organizing all the necessary ingredients, tools, and equipment before starting to cook. This includes chopping vegetables, measuring out ingredients, and arranging everything in a systematic manner for efficient cooking.
The concept of mise en place is highly valued in professional kitchens as it promotes efficiency, accuracy, and smooth workflow. By having everything ready and within reach, chefs and cooks can focus on the actual cooking process without having to search for ingredients or tools. It helps to streamline the cooking process, prevent mistakes, and ensure that each dish is prepared consistently.
